FAQ
Q: Can inverters work during blackouts? A: Grid-tied models require special configuration for island mode operation.
Q: How long do inverters typically last? A: Quality units operate 10-15 years with proper maintenance.
Q: What's the efficiency difference between models? A> Premium inverters achieve 98-99% vs. 95-97% in entry-level units.
